Psycho 2

Country: USA, Language: English, 113 mins

  • Director: Richard Franklin
  • Writer: Tom Holland; Robert Bloch
  • Producer: Hilton A. Green; Bernard Schwartz

The(ir) Blurb...

Now declared legally sane, Norman Bates is released from a mental institution after spending 22 years in confinement over the protests of Marion Crane's sister Lila Loomis, who insists that he's still a killer and that the court's indifference to his victims by releasing him is a gross miscarriage of justice. Norman returns to his motel and the old Victorian mansion where his troubles started, and history predictably begins to repeat itself.
